According to 6Wresearch internal database and industry insights, the Global Glass Vials Market was valued at USD 7 Billion in 2024 and is expected to reach USD 10.2 Billion by 2031, growing at a compound annual growth rate of 5.50% during the forecast period (2025-2031).
The Global Glass Vials Market is experiencing steady growth due to the increased demand for reliable and safe packaging solutions in the pharmaceutical, healthcare, and cosmetic industries. The market is driven by factors such as the rising adoption of prefilled syringes and injectable drugs, stringent regulations regarding packaging materials, and the shift towards eco-friendly and sustainable packaging options. Glass vials are preferred for their superior barrier properties, resistance to chemical interactions, and recyclability. Key players in the market are focusing on innovation, product customization, and strategic collaborations to cater to the diverse requirements of end-users. The market is expected to witness further growth with the increasing emphasis on quality control measures, product safety, and the growing prevalence of chronic diseases requiring effective drug delivery systems.

Government policies related to the Global Glass Vials Market primarily focus on ensuring product quality, safety, and environmental sustainability. Regulatory bodies such as the FDA in the United States and the European Medicines Agency (EMA) in the EU have established guidelines for the production, labeling, and distribution of glass vials used for pharmaceuticals and vaccines. These regulations aim to maintain stringent quality standards, prevent contamination, and ensure proper storage and transportation practices. Additionally, environmental agencies worldwide are promoting the use of eco-friendly practices in glass vial manufacturing to reduce carbon footprint and minimize waste generation. Compliance with these government policies is essential for glass vial manufacturers to operate in the market and meet the growing demand for safe and sustainable packaging solutions.

The global glass vials market is experiencing varying trends across regions. In Asia, particularly in countries like China and India, the market is witnessing significant growth due to the expanding pharmaceutical and healthcare industries. North America is a mature market with a focus on sustainability and technological advancements in vial manufacturing. In Europe, stringent regulations regarding packaging materials are driving demand for high-quality glass vials. The Middle East and Africa region is showing steady growth with increasing investments in healthcare infrastructure. Latin America is witnessing moderate growth, driven by the increasing adoption of glass vials in the pharmaceutical sector. Overall, the global glass vials market is expected to continue growing, with each region contributing differently based on market dynamics and industry trends.
